SOMETHING TO SHOUT ABOUT [film]
- Title
- SOMETHING TO SHOUT ABOUT [film]
- Release Date
- 1943
- Genre
- film
- Production and Recordings Information
- Soundtrack. MUSIC & WORDS: Cole Porter. COND: Morris Stoloff. Orchestra: Main Title Janet Blair, Don Ameche: "You'd Be So Nice to Come Home to," "I Always Knew" Blair, Hazel Scott (piano): "Through Thick and Thin" Blair, Jaye Martin: "I Always Knew" Blair: "Something to Shout about," "Lotus Bloom," "Hasta Luego" Ensemble: "Through Thick and Thin/Finale" (ALB-655)
- Note
- From: Show Music on Record by Jack Raymond
